Abstract

Purpose: This research aims to analyze the influence of work discipline, work environment, and work motivation on employee performance at Bank Syariah Indonesia (BSI) Palopo City. Methodology: This study uses a quantitative approach with a survey method. The research population consists of all employees of Bank Syariah Indonesia (BSI) in Palopo City. The sampling technique used was saturated sampling, so the entire population was made respondents, totaling 50 people (n=50). Data analysis was conducted through validity tests, reliability tests, classical assumptions, and multiple linear regression with the help of SPSS version 26. Results: The research results show that work discipline, work environment, and work motivation have a positive and significant effect on employee performance, both partially and simultaneously. Findings: The findings confirm that improving work discipline, work environment, and work motivation is very important in enhancing employee performance. Novelty & Originality: This study offers novelty by examining these three variables in the context of a sharia bank in Palopo City, a regional setting rarely explored in prior research. Conclusions: The study concludes that integrated improvements in discipline, environment, and motivation are essential for optimizing employee performance. Type of Paper: This paper is an empirical research paper.
